4D.
If you happen to play 2NT as some kind of Lebensohl,
than it is either 3D or 2NT followed by 3D.
As it is, this is certainly not standard, and the hand is
too strong for a simple 3D bid.
This of course assumes, that X showed both minors,
and may not be based on a bal. hand with 10-12.
With kind regards
Marlowe
PS: 4D is certainly not forcing, but highly invitational.
